History and Origin
The Air Jordan line has long been a staple of basketball culture and street fashion. The 12th silhouette, first introduced in the 1990s, gained fame thanks to Michael Jordan’s performances on the court. The Retro GG "Hornets" edition, released in 2016, pays homage to the classic design while adding its own flair. This colourway echoes the energy of the Hornets team — it’s a nod to basketball heritage with a modern twist.
Technology and Construction
The Air Jordan 12 Retro GG builds on the original’s balanced blend of style and performance DNA. The model keeps the signature structural elements that made the 12s stand out: clean lines, layered details and a confident profile. Underfoot, the Air cushioning unit offers basic impact absorption — a hallmark of the Air Jordan range. Construction focuses on durability without sacrificing the retro look. It’s built to last, yet stays true to the vintage aesthetic.
